Along with Aries, as I mentioned in this post, Cancer and Gemini are two strong energies that we have been working with since 2024 and will continue to work with over the next year (and beyond). If any of your “Big 3” (Rising, Sun, Moon) or the ruler of your rising sign are in Cancer or Gemini, then you are on a journey of self-discovery and transformation. Pluto gets associated with “transformation,” but all of the planets have the opportunity for transformation in their own way, including Mars, Jupiter, and Uranus, which will be the focus of this post.
The Gemini and Cancer energies were sparked last year in 2024 when Jupiter moved into Gemini and Mars moved into Cancer, where it ended up stationing retrograde at the beginning of 2025. In June of 2025, Jupiter will move into Cancer, and in July 2025, Uranus will move into Gemini. Jupiter will stay in Cancer for a whole year until June 2026. Uranus previews Gemini until November when it will go back to Taurus one last time before taking up residence in Gemini in 2026 for seven years. Gemini folks are on a seven year journey of self-discovery. Cancer’s self-discovery is a lot less than that, but it’s still important, especially since Jupiter is exalted in Cancer, and this will feel like much needed sunshine after months of the downpour Mars has represented during its time in the Moon’s sign.
If you’re Cancer or Gemini Rising, then you are experiencing this self-transformation the most since your Rising Sign is the most personal part of you that represents self, personhood, your body, and how you identify. If you are Cancer or Gemini Sun, you will also experience this transformation as the Sun represents your identity, mind, and how you shine. If you are Cancer or Gemini Moon, then your home, living situation, environment, needs, and what nurtures you is going through a transformation. Also, if the ruler of your Rising Sign is in Gemini or Cancer, then you will experience one of these transformations as well.
Jupiter expands. It’s also the big picture. When Jupiter is transiting your Rising Sign, it expands your perspective of yourself and how you identify. It inspires you to think beyond yourself as well and look at yourself in the context of the bigger picture of life. Jupiter invites you to connect more with who you are on a soul level. How you identity and who you think you are can go through a transformation because Jupiter is expanding the horizons of your personhood.
For Geminis, this transformation began back in June, 2024 when Jupiter first moved into Gemini. This expansion will begin for Cancers in June of this year, 2025, when Jupiter moves into Cancer. But, then, in July 2025, Uranus will move into Gemini, so for Geminis, the transformation continues. For Geminis, Jupiter has been expanding your sense of self so that when Uranus moves there, you will feel ready to live a completely different life. Uranus shakes up the old ways of doing things. It’s a disrupter, an earthquake shattering what you thought you knew, how you thought you were going to do things, or what you thought you wanted. Come July, Geminis will feel like doing things very differently in their lives, and some will be desiring to live an entirely different life altogether. Once Uranus settles in Gemini in 2026, it will be there for seven years, so this is a longer period of transformation. For Gemini Risings, especially, in seven years, you will not be the same person you thought you were. While growth is never easy, this is an exciting time for Geminis. Its *your* time to revolutionize yourself and your life.
For Cancers, you’ve been experiencing your fair share of challenges since Mars entered your sign back in early September, 2024. Early September to early November of 2024 was, especially, difficult for Cancers because Mars was in Cancer opposing Pluto in Capricorn, and a Mars-Pluto opposition is one of the most challenging aspects. Then, in early January of 2025, Mars went retrograde in Cancer, but, this may not have been quite as extreme as before because Pluto was no longer aspecting Mars as it was in Aquarius by then. Still, a Mars retrograde in Cancer is tough because Mars retrogrades in general are tough. But, also, Mars is in its fall in the sign of Cancer because Cancer is the opposite sign of its exaltation, Capricorn, so it struggles more in that sign.
However, while Mars retrogrades are generally more challenging times, they can be periods that are, ultimately, trying to help you. Mars represents a lot of challenging things, but it also represents where you put your action and energy, and what motivates you. Mars provides opportunities for growth, and growth isn’t often easy. For Cancer Risings, this has been about your self, identity, issues with your physical body, and your life in general. For Cancer Suns, this has been about your vitality, how you’re recognized or want to be recognized, where you shine, as well as how you identify. For Cancer Moons, this has been about your physical body, home, living situation, getting your needs met or challenges to getting your needs met, what you need to feel nourished and nurtured, and possibly issues with your mother or a motherly figure in your life (perhaps yourself as a mother, even).
Think about what themes have been in focus for you during the Mars in Cancer time. Cancer is the sign of humankind, it represents our spirits entering the human body. Cancer is ruled by the Moon. In Hellenistic astrology, the Moon was associated with mother, the body, home, and our needs. It is the giving of life. As a water, cardinal sign, Cancer needs to create and give birth to something, whether that's human beings or creative projects or passions. Cancer needs something(s) to nurture.
Hang on, Cancer Risings, Suns, and Moons! While this Mars in Cancer time has been challenging, there are blessings coming up in June when Jupiter moves into Cancer for a whole year! This will be positive for everyone, but it will be, especially, beneficial for Cancer folks. If you’ve been putting a lot of effort into the Cancer part of your chart/life, then it’s likely that you will reap positive results from those efforts when Jupiter is in Cancer. Mars in Cancer was brewing something new that you want to bring into the world. Jupiter moving there soon wants to give life to what you’ve been creating or nurturing.
